AppMaster 와 같은 코드 없는 플랫폼의 맥락에서 사용자 스토리는 소프트웨어 개발 프로세스의 필수 요소이며 최종 사용자의 목표, 목표 및 요구 사항을 설명하고 나타내는 효과적인 방법을 제공합니다. 사용자 스토리는 소프트웨어 요구 사항에 대한 간결하고 이해하기 쉬운 내러티브 역할을 하며 애플리케이션에 참여하게 될 사람들의 의도와 관점을 포착합니다. 이를 통해 개발자는 대상 청중을 더 잘 이해하고 공감할 수 있으며 기능 및 업데이트의 우선 순위를 지정하고 검증할 수 있습니다. 사용자 스토리는 복잡한 시스템 요구 사항을 민첩한 방법론과 반복 개발을 지원하는 구조화된 형식으로 변환합니다.
사용자 스토리의 핵심 구성 요소에는 특정 기능에 대한 간단한 설명, 사용자 역할 식별, 제공할 가치 또는 이점에 대한 집중 설명이 포함됩니다. 사용자 스토리는 일반적으로 "[사용자 역할]로서 [가치]를 위한 [기능]을 원합니다"라는 형식으로 표현됩니다. 이 세 부분으로 구성된 구조는 고려 중인 기능이 사용자 요구 사항과 직접적으로 일치하도록 보장하고 최종 응용 프로그램 디자인은 사용자의 개선을 충족시킵니다. 이 일관되고 보편적으로 적용 가능한 형식을 사용하면 프로젝트 이해 관계자 간의 의사 소통이 개선되고 의사 결정 프로세스가 빨라집니다.
사용자 스토리를 애플리케이션 개발의 핵심 측면으로 활용하면 몇 가지 이점이 있습니다. 첫째, 전체 프로젝트 요구 사항을 세분화하여 표시하여 계획 및 우선 순위 지정을 단순화합니다. 이를 통해 팀은 리소스를 할당하고 실현 가능한 타임라인을 개발하며 애플리케이션의 기능 증분을 지속적으로 제공할 수 있습니다. 둘째, 사용자 스토리는 디자이너, 개발자 및 프로젝트 이해 관계자 간의 건설적인 토론을 촉진하여 향상된 협업을 촉진합니다. 이 협업을 통해 최종 제품이 원래의 비전과 사용자 기대에 부합하도록 보장합니다. 셋째, 사용자 스토리의 고유한 유연성으로 인해 프로젝트 범위 또는 사용자 요구의 변화에 빠르게 적응할 수 있습니다. 결과적으로 이러한 반복 개발은 잘못 정렬되거나 부적절한 최종 제품을 제공할 위험을 줄입니다.
no-code 강력한 애플리케이션 개발 플랫폼인 AppMaster 사용자 스토리의 원칙을 흡수하여 애플리케이션 아이디어를 완전히 실현된 백엔드, 웹 및 모바일 솔루션으로 변환합니다. AppMaster 에서 제공하는 시각적 디자인 및 청사진 작성 기능을 활용하여 개발자는 사용자 스토리에서 설명하는 명시적 요구 사항에 맞는 애플리케이션을 효율적으로 개발할 수 있습니다. 이렇게 하면 결과 애플리케이션이 효율적이고 안정적이며 사용자 친화적이 되어 사용자 경험이 향상되고 기업의 전반적인 투자 수익(ROI)이 향상됩니다.
예를 들어, 가상의 전자 상거래 애플리케이션에 대한 사용자 스토리를 생각해 보십시오. 이 경우 직관적이고 효율적인 쇼핑 경험으로 애플리케이션을 개발하여 카트에 제품을 추가하는 프로세스가 원활하고 접근 가능하도록 해야 합니다. AppMaster 통해 개발 팀은 이 사용자 스토리를 기반으로 데이터 모델을 생성하고, 사용자 인터페이스를 설계하고, 비즈니스 로직을 구성할 수 있습니다. 시각적 중심 디자인 프로세스는 솔루션의 신속한 프로토타이핑 및 반복을 용이하게 하여 팀이 실제 사용자와 함께 기능을 검증하고 피드백을 수집하며 개발 프로세스 전체에서 애플리케이션을 최적화할 수 있도록 합니다.
사용자 스토리는 사용자 요구 사항을 이해하고 우선 순위를 지정하기 위한 AppMaster 와 같은 no-code 플랫폼 영역에서 귀중한 도구입니다. AppMaster 의 직관적인 시각적 디자인 인터페이스, 포괄적인 개발 에코시스템 및 Go, Vue3, Kotlin 및 SwiftUI 와 같은 업계 표준 기술 지원을 통해 소프트웨어 개발 팀은 사용자의 요구에 맞는 애플리케이션을 효율적으로 구축할 수 있습니다. 사용자 스토리와 AppMaster 의 기능을 수용함으로써 기업은 더 빠르고 비용 효율적이며 사용자 중심의 애플리케이션 개발을 보장하여 우수한 사용자 경험, 개선된 시장 경쟁력 및 더 높은 투자 수익으로 이어질 수 있습니다.